Craigmont was not able to break out of their rough patch on Saturday as the team picked up their fifth straight loss. They fell 52-40 to the Millington Central Trojans. While losing is never fun, the Chiefs can't take it too hard given the team's big disadvantage in MaxPreps' Tennessee basketball rankings (they are ranked 352nd, while the Trojans are ranked 156th).
Arianna Whiten was the offensive standout of the game as she posted 13 points. Arionna Banks was another key player, putting up six points.
Craigmont's defeat dropped their record down to 6-16. As for Millington Central, they are on a roll lately: they've won six of their last seven matches. That's provided a massive bump to their 18-10 record this season.
